Hypnosis is a valuable method that can be used as an adjunct to other therapies or as a free standing therapy. I am one of a relatively small group of therapists authorized to provide a specialized hypnotherapy protocol to treat irritable bowel syndrome, IBS. For many years, I used hypnosis in the treatment of smoking and other addictions. In my work with athletes, hypnosis is quite useful in improving performance. Hypnosis can also be helpful in managing sleep issues including insomnia.

Raleigh sits at the heart of the Research Triangle alongside Durham and Chapel Hill, and its concentration of biotech, pharmaceutical, and university workers drives consistent demand for therapists experienced with perfectionism, burnout, and the psychological costs of competitive knowledge-economy careers. The region's rapid growth has made Raleigh one of the fastest-growing cities in the United States, and therapists frequently address the adjustment, social isolation, and identity challenges common among transplants rebuilding lives in a new city. WakeMed Health and UNC REX Healthcare serve as institutional anchors alongside a well-established private practice community across North Hills, Midtown, and the Five Points area. Raleigh's growing diversity — with large South Asian, Latino, and Black professional communities — is increasing demand for culturally affirming and multilingual therapists.
Hypnotherapy therapists in Raleigh, North Carolina Statistics
Hypnotherapy therapists in Raleigh, North Carolina average 16 years of experience and charge around $190 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The top treatment approaches are Hypnotherapy (91%),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) (63%), and Somatic Therapy (38%).
